Enroll your staff in our online EYE Training Courses
Registering for this new online training provides educators with the independence to learn at their own pace and reduces the need for in-person group training. Access is granted for the entire school year, so staff can refer to any required reading, resources, or videos as needed. You can monitor users' completion, so no manual follow-up is required. Individual licenses are $195 per participant*. Register now!
Note: As always, we have a number of additional training materials in the ‘Resource and Help’ section of our website, if you choose to do training with your staff yourself.
*If you are using the EYE under a provincial contract in Manitoba or Saskatchewan, all EYE LMS licenses are paid for by the province.

Implementation Updates
Access sessions early: EYE coordinators can access sessions one week before teachers do. Review the setup in the system and respond to any last-minute changes before the session opens for everyone.
Easier user management: Add new staff to your session by simply clicking on the Add User+ button on the main page. The system will walk you through the process.
New Practice Accounts: Learn how to edit class lists, enter scores, and generate reports in a safe environment! Email us for more info.
We also have our Early Years Evaluation - Pre-Reading Assessment (EYE-PR) available this school year! A complementary assessment to the EYE-TA, the EYE-PR provides educators with valuable insights into each child’s early reading skills and identifies their next steps.
This brief 15-20-minute assessment measures foundational literacy skills. Aligned resources, activities, and comprehensive reports help educators tailor their teaching strategies and give caregivers what they need to provide targeted support at home.
